Aluminum MIC-6 is produced using a continuous casting process, resulting in extremely low residual stress and minimal warping after machining. It offers excellent flatness, surface finish, and machinability. However, due to its limited strength and fatigue performance, it is not suitable for high-load structural applications.

Material Properties

Mechanical Properties

  • Yield strength

    160–170 MPa

  • Tensile strength

    230 - 260 MPa

  • Elongation

    3–7%

  • Hardness

    70 - 85 HB

  • Young's modulus

    70 - 72 GPa

Thermal properties

  • Maximum operating temperature

    150 - 180 °C

  • Thermal conductivity

    140 - 155 W/(m·K)

  • Coefficient of thermal expansion

    21.5 - 22.5 μm/(m·°C)

Physical Properties

  • Density

    2.7 g/cm³

Electrical properties

  • Electrical resistivity

    4.5 - 5.5 μΩ·cm

Manufacturability

  • Manufacturability-Corrosion resistance

    Good

  • Manufacturability-Weldability

    Poor
